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Kleines Bahama-Trichterohr | Felten-Kleinwühlmaus |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Mammalia (Säugetiere)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Fledertiere) | Rodentia (Nagetiere) |
| Family | Natalid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Chilonatalus | Microtus |
| Species | Chilonatalus tumidifrons | Microtus felteni |
Evolutionary Relationship
Kleines Bahama-Trichterohr and Felten-Kleinwühlmaus share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Säugetiere)
